The 225 represents the approximate section width or width of the tire from sidewall to sidewall. The larger the number, the wider the tire. The 60 refers to the aspect ratio, which is the nominal sidewall height reflected as a percentage of section width. Buy GlueTread Sidewall Tire Repair Kit | Patch Sidewall of Your Tire | Kit Includes (1) 4"x4.5"x3/16 Patch (4) Pieces of Sandpaper, Adhesive & Instructions | Atv Tire Repair Kit for Off-Road use Only: Tire Repair Tools - Amazon.com FREE DELIVERY possible on eligible purchasesTires are made up of a few internal layers of material for structural integrity. A large impact like hitting a pothole can cause damage to those internal layers. Once those inner layers are breached and the sidewall of the tire is exposed internally, the air pressure will cause the sidewall rubber to start forming a bubble.
